What is an appropriate unit of measure to express the length of a dollar bill?
- A. Meters
- B. Decimeters
- C. Kilometers
- D. Centimeters
Correct Answer: D
Rationale: Dollar bills are relatively small items, so their length is commonly measured in centimeters. Meters, decimeters, and kilometers are much larger units of length, making centimeters the most suitable unit to accurately express the length of a dollar bill. Centimeters provide a more precise and practical measurement for the size of a dollar bill compared to the other options, which are more suitable for larger distances or objects.

When a person increases cycling speed, the rate of calories burned, distance traveled, and energy expended also increase. Which of the following is the independent variable?
- A. Speed
- B. Energy
- C. Distance
- D. Calories
Correct Answer: A
Rationale: In the context of this scenario, the independent variable is the factor that is deliberately altered or controlled to observe its impact on other variables. When a person adjusts their cycling speed, it directly influences the rate of calories burned, distance traveled, and energy expended. Speed is the independent variable because it is manipulated to study its effects on the dependent variables - calories burned, distance traveled, and energy expended. Therefore, the correct answer is 'Speed.'

A circle has an area of 49π square inches. What is the circumference of the circle in terms of π?
- A. 7Ï€ in
- B. 14Ï€ in
- C. 28Ï€ in
- D. 3.5Ï€ in
Correct Answer: B
Rationale: To find the circumference of a circle in terms of π, we first determine the radius using the formula for the area of a circle, A = πr^2. Given that the area is 49π square inches, we have 49π = πr^2, which simplifies to r = 7. The circumference of a circle is calculated using the formula C = 2πr. Substituting r = 7, we get C = 2π(7) = 14π. Therefore, the circumference of the circle is 14π inches.
